Redcare Pharmacy NV (ETR:RDC) has an intriguing ownership structure, with retail investors holding a 34% stake and institutions owning 32%. This balance of ownership can significantly influence the company's strategic decision-making, risk management, capital-raising ability, dividend policy, and shareholder returns. Let's delve into the implications of this ownership structure and its potential impact on RDC's future.
Retail investors, with their 34% stake, bring a diverse range of perspectives and backgrounds to the table. Their focus on long-term growth can align with the company's strategic objectives, fostering a collaborative environment for decision-making. However, retail investors' emotional nature can also lead to increased stock price volatility. To mitigate this, RDC should focus on improving communication, transparency, and investor education.
Institutions, with their 32% stake, typically have longer investment horizons and prioritize long-term growth. They can provide steady support and facilitate larger capital raises, enhancing RDC's ability to adapt to market changes. However, institutions may have differing opinions on risk tolerance compared to retail investors, potentially leading to differing views on strategic direction.
The balance between retail and institutional investors can impact RDC's dividend policy and shareholder returns. Retail investors, being more risk-averse, tend to prefer stable and predictable dividends. Institutions, on the other hand, may prioritize capital appreciation and reinvestment of earnings into growth opportunities. This balance can result in a more conservative dividend policy, ensuring that retail investors are satisfied while institutions still see potential for capital gains.

To foster long-term growth and value creation, RDC should engage and communicate effectively with its retail investor base. This can be achieved through a multi-faceted approach that leverages digital platforms, transparent communication, and educational resources. By establishing a user-friendly investor relations website and mobile app, hosting Q&A sessions and webinars, and offering educational resources, RDC can create a loyal following that supports its long-term objectives.
In conclusion, Redcare Pharmacy NV's ownership structure, dominated by retail and institutional investors, presents both opportunities and challenges. By understanding and addressing the unique needs and preferences of these investor groups, RDC can create a strategic approach that balances short-term market opportunities with long-term growth prospects. Effective communication and engagement with investors will be key to unlocking the full potential of this ownership structure.
